As a part of the Internal Quality Assurance Cell (IQAC) initiatives, KV Institute of Management and Information Studies recently conducted a Capacity Building Program on Office Management for the non-teaching staff of the institution.

This program aimed to enhance skills in office tools and communication practices essential for modern administrative functions.

In a unique and empowering approach, the session was conducted by students, who guided the non-teaching staff through practical demonstrations and hands-on exercises. This student-led initiative created an engaging learning environment and fostered mutual respect and collaboration across different roles within the institution.
